The 2016 Rio Olympics are going to be something to watch, from the unfoldingcontroversiesto theuplifting storiesof athletes making their way to Brazil.
There are 19 days of Olympics viewing, from women's soccer on Aug. 3, two days before the opening ceremony to the closing ceremony on Aug. 21. Daytime programming will be from 10 a.m. to 5 p.m., primetime 8 p.m. to midnight, late-night from 12:35 a.m. to 1:35 a.m., and replays from 1:35 a.m. to 4:30 a.m.
Despite the games bringing together competitors from around the world, coverage is not so universal. The International Olympic Committee will not show thegames on its YouTube channeluntil they are over, but there are other options.
NBCOlympics.comhaslive streams, replays, and all sorts of extras, but you have to be a cable TV subscriber to access it all. NBC will again allow viewers to watch 30 minutes of video before signing in, though.

NBC Sports
TheNBC Sports appcontains coverage from NBC, NBC Sports Network, and the Golf Channel. The app is available for iOS, Android, and Windows.
Telemundo Deportes
The Telemundo Deportes app has Telemundo's coverage to go. It's available foriOSandAndroid.

Sling
If you're a Sling Blue customer, then you get live coverage from NBC (if it'savailable on Sling in your area) NBCSN, Bravo and USA. As with all Sling services, you can watch on your computer, mobile device, set-top box and gaming console.
